The ingredients needed to make Gramma Evies Banana Bread:
  1. Get 1 C Crisco - I prefer butter flavored
  2. Take 4 Eggs
  3. Prepare 1 tsp salt
  4. Prepare 3 C Sugar
  5. Prepare Mix the following 3 ingredients in a bowl:
  6. Take 1 C Milk
  7. Take 2 Tbs vinegar
  8. Make ready And 2 tsp soda - stir & it will fiz
  9. Make ready 4 C Flour
  10. Prepare 6 Bananas
  11. Take 2 tsp Vanilla
  12. Get Walnuts or choc chips optional
Steps to make Gramma Evies Banana Bread:
  1. Mix the 1st four ingredients together
  2. Alternately add milk and flour
  3. Add bananas & vanilla
  4. Add Chocolate chips or walnuts if you want
  5. Grease pans (you could sprinkle cinnamon/sugar mixture in your pans to coat outside of Bread if you want). If you're doing a batch of small loaves they should be done in about 45-50 minutes. I keep an eye on since every oven is different. Two large loaves will take 45-50 minutes also. Check on & make sure toothpick comes out clean. Let cool and remove.
  6. Enjoy!
